Latest Patents

Bolan holds a patent titled "Method and apparatus for spinning hollow fiber membranes." This patent describes a process for preparing anisotropic hollow fibers that are useful as permselective separation membranes. The process involves extruding a spinning dope through a spinneret that extends into a coagulation chamber maintained at subatmospheric pressure. The nascent hollow fiber is conveyed through a column that extends into the reduced pressure chamber and contains at least two different abutting liquids arranged in sequence. The apparatus for conducting this process includes the vacuum chamber, the spinneret, and the column equipped with entrance and exit ports for the introduction and removal of at least two abutting liquid coagulation media.

Career Highlights

Bolan is associated with Praxair Technology, Inc., where he has been able to apply his expertise in membrane technology. His work has contributed to advancements in the field, particularly in the development of efficient separation processes.

Collaborations

Throughout his career, Bolan has collaborated with notable colleagues, including James Timothy Macheras and Benjamin Bikson. These collaborations have likely enhanced the innovation and application of his patented technologies.
